B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ION 1. Field of the Invention The present invention relates to a cleaning composition suitable for cleaning precision metal parts, printed circuit boards, etc., which can be replaced with a fluorocarbon-based or chlorine-based cleaning agent.

Description of the Related Art Hitherto, chlorofluoroethane-based compounds (fluorocarbons) and chlorine-based solvents such as trichloroethane and trichloroethylene have been widely used as cleaning agents, particularly industrial cleaning agents such as machines and instruments. These solvents have the selective solubility of dissolving fats, oils, greases, waxes, and the like, and have the remarkable advantage of nonflammability, and are widely used.

In recent years, however, some types of chlorofluorocarbons, such as chlorofluorocarbon 113, and chlorinated solvents, such as 1,1,1-trichloroethane, have excellent cleaning effects, but have a global environmental problem of depletion of the ozone layer. In terms of
In recent years, regulations or restrictions on production and use have been made, or
Its use has been problematic internationally. Therefore, instead of these cleaning agents, cleaning agents of alcohol type, terpene type and hydrocarbon type have been studied. However,
All of these have insufficient detergency, are flammable,
There are problems such as high foaming property, detergency not sustained, and damage to the object to be cleaned. Further, there has been proposed a cleaning agent in which a hydrophobic solvent and water are co-dissolved through the intermediation of a water-soluble solvent to exclude dangerous substances under the Fire Service Law (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 2-29).
No. 4093), however, it is difficult to obtain a uniform detergent, and even if the surfactant is used for homogenization, not only a surfactant having a low HLB is difficult to homogenize but also an insufficient point such as easy foaming. Many. In the cleaning agent proposed in JP-A-3-9772, water is added to a water-soluble glycol ether-based solvent, but the detergency is reduced by adding water. JP-A-3-62895 discloses a polyalkylene glycol monoalkyl (having 6 to 22 carbon atoms).
Further, US Pat. No. 3,886,099 and JP-A-4-57897 propose that a detergent using an ether is used in combination with a glycol ether and an amine. However, in the former, a specific water-soluble glycol ether is preferred, and in the latter two, a glycol ether having a hydrocarbon residue having 4 to 14 carbon atoms is particularly preferred. As described above, the use of amines improves the detergency, but the dissolving power is not sufficient, and the detergency is not only long-lasting, but also has insufficient plasticity and is still satisfactory. Has not been obtained.

A first feature of the present invention is that a polypropylene glycol monoalkyl ether solvent represented by the above-mentioned general formula (I) having a relatively low water solubility and the above-mentioned general formula (I)
A polyethylene glycol alkyl ether-based solvent which is completely dissolved in water represented by I), the alkanolamine represented by the general formula (III), and water are mixed at a specific concentration to obtain a detergent composition. As a result, it is exempt from hazardous materials under the Fire Services Act, and has extremely excellent cleaning power even for dirt such as wax, resin and grease, and
It has a long lasting detergency and a good stability against metals and plastics.

As a solvent having low water solubility, there is a completely water-insoluble solvent such as a hydrocarbon compound which has been conventionally used, and such a completely water-insoluble solvent is a stable detergent when mixed with water. Because it is difficult to obtain
It is necessary to have hydrophilicity, and a polypropylene glycol monoalkyl ether solvent is most suitable. On the other hand, the water-soluble solvent alone has a weak detergency against oily stains.

Therefore, by blending a completely water-soluble polyethylene glycol alkyl ether-based solvent and the above-mentioned polypropylene glycol monoalkyl ether-based solvent in a specific ratio, the solvent has an ability to dissolve various stains such as wax, resin and grease. The present invention has been found not only to be able to dramatically improve, but also to obtain a surprising result that the stability against metals and plastics is extremely good, thereby completing the present invention. Here, when the amount of the polypropylene glycol monoalkyl ether-based solvent represented by the general formula (I) is too large in the combination of the two solvents, the durability of the detergency decreases. On the other hand, when the amount of the polyethylene glycol alkyl ether-based solvent represented by the above general formula (II) is too large, the detergency against oily stains and the stability against plastics and metals are reduced. Therefore, it is necessary to mix and use both types of solvents, and the mixing ratio is important. This mixing ratio is usually 0.1 to 0.1 as a weight ratio of the compound represented by the general formula (I) to the compound represented by the general formula (II).
5, preferably 0.2 to 2. When the mixing ratio is out of the above range, a cleaning composition having excellent detergency, long lasting detergency, and excellent stability against plastics and metals cannot be obtained.

Representative examples of the polypropylene glycol monoalkyl ether solvent represented by the general formula (I) having relatively low water solubility in the present invention include di, tri and
Monopropyl ether of tetrapropylene glycol,
Examples include monobutyl ether and monopentyl ether. The amount of the detergent composition of the present invention (the compound represented by the above general formula (I), the compound represented by the above general formula (II) and the compound represented by the above general formula (III) and water The sum of the weights of each
Medium, 10 to 70% by weight, preferably 15 to 50% by weight
It is said. If this amount is less than 10% by weight, the plasticity is reduced, while if it exceeds 70% by weight, the durability of the detergency is reduced.

The polyethylene glycol alkyl ether solvent which is completely soluble in water and represented by the general formula (II) used in the present invention is a mono- or di-alkyl ether of polyethylene glycol. Monoethyl ether, diethyl ether, monopropyl ether, dipropyl ether, monobutyl ether and dibutyl ether of di, tri and tetraethylene glycol are included. Its usage is
In the cleaning composition of the present invention, it is 15 to 80% by weight, preferably 30 to 70% by weight. If this amount is less than 15% by weight, it is difficult to obtain a uniform composition when mixed with water,
On the other hand, if it exceeds 80% by weight, the stability to plastic decreases.

A second feature of the present invention is that an alkanolamine represented by the above general formula (III) is further used in combination. Thereby, the detergent composition of the present invention exhibits extremely high detergency even without adding a detersive surfactant. Further, it not only enhances the detergency, but also has a high rust prevention property against metals and has a long lasting detergency. As a result, the object to be cleaned can be cleaned without being corroded, and the running cost can be reduced.
The used amount is 5 to 15% by weight, preferably 6 to 10% by weight in the cleaning composition of the present invention. If the amount used is less than 5% by weight, both the detergency and rust resistance are reduced, and the durability of the detergency is shortened. On the other hand, if it exceeds 15% by weight, the viscosity increases and the detergency also increases the amount used. It doesn't rise as much as it did.

Further, the amount of water used is also important, and is 5 to 10% by weight in the cleaning composition of the present invention. If the amount of water used exceeds 10% by weight, the detergency decreases, while if the amount of water used is less than 5% by weight, it shows a flash point and is regarded as a dangerous substance under the Fire Service Law.

EXAMPLES The present invention will be described in more detail with reference to the following examples, but the present invention is not limited to these examples. Example 1 The following components were placed in a flask and stirred at 50 ° C. for 30 minutes to obtain a detergent composition. Dipropylene glycol monopropyl ether 30% by weight Diethylene glycol monobutyl ether 50 {Triethanolamine 10} Water 10 >> The obtained detergent composition was evaluated for detergency, long lasting detergency and stability to various materials. The results are shown in Tables 3 to 7. That is, Table 3 shows the evaluation of the detergency and the detergency of the detergency, Tables 4 and 5 show the evaluation results of the stability against plastic, and Tables 6 and 7 show the stability against the metal. Evaluation method for cleaning performance The surface of a printed circuit board soldered with solder paste is
The composition was washed with the detergent composition of the present invention (hereinafter sometimes simply referred to as a detergent) and evaluated by the following.

Soldering process of printed circuit board Printed circuit board ICB-4.5 cm × 7.0 cm made by Sunhayato
86G was coated with solder paste CS63S manufactured by Nippon Filler Metals Co., Ltd., and soldered at 250 ° C. for 10 seconds.

Washing conditions 200 g of the detergent was put in a 200 ml beaker and heated to 60 ° C. The printed circuit board was immersed for 2 minutes while stirring at 150 rpm. Next, this is added to water 20 at room temperature.
After being immersed in 0 ml for 1 minute, the state of cleaning of the surface of the printed circuit board rinsed with running water was visually observed, and judged by ionic residues.

Evaluation method of sustainability of detergency 19.6 g of rosin and 0.2 g of stearic acid per 180 g of detergent
And 0.2 g of diethylamine hydrochloride are dissolved and 10%
A synthetic soil solution was evaluated under the same washing conditions as in the above-described method for evaluating washability, except that this solution was used in place of the detergent under the above wash conditions.

Evaluation Method for Stability to Plastic 200 g of a detergent was placed in a 200 ml beaker and heated at 60 ° C. Various plastic test pieces were immersed for 10 minutes while stirring at 150 rpm. Next, this was immersed in 200 ml of water at room temperature for 1 minute, and then the state of the surface of the plastic test piece washed with running water was visually observed.
And it evaluated by the weight change rate.

Evaluation method for stability against metal Put 50 g of a detergent in a 50 ml sample bottle, immerse various metal test pieces in this while heating in a constant temperature bath at 50 ° C., and then leave at room temperature for 4 hours. Then, the state of the surface of the metal test piece after washing with acetone was visually observed, and evaluated by the weight change rate.

The cleaning composition of the present invention has the following advantages: (1) It has excellent detergency, for example, it has particularly excellent detergency against flux, oil, grease, wax and the like. (2) Since it has good resistance to metals and plastics, it is suitably used for cleaning various printed circuit boards and metal parts. (3) Long-lasting detergency enables long-term use, thus reducing running costs. Therefore, the cleaning composition of the present invention is widely and suitably used in various cleaning methods as an alternative to the conventional fluorocarbon and chlorine-based cleaning agents.
